What is the equation of the line that passes through the point(6,4) and has a slope of -2/3

Respuesta :

yourgirlafreen yourgirlafreen
  • 13-11-2020

Answer:

y=-2/3x+8

Step-by-step explanation:

first, find the y intercept, or b.

write your equation so far: y = -2/3x + b

Now substitute in your given point (6,4)

so now we got: 4 = -2/3(6) + b

which gives you: 4 = -4 + b

Now, we find b.

4 = -4 + b  

+4    +4      < isolating b...

8 = b

now put it back in..

y=-2/3x+b
